<p>The main objective of this research work is to analysis the voltage stability of the power system network and its improvement in the network.voltage stability of a power system. A system enters a state of voltage instability when a disturbance, increase in load demand, or change in system condition causes a progressive and an uncontrollable drop in voltage or voltage collapse. The continuing increase in demand for electric power has resulted in an increasingly complex, interconnected system, forced to operate closer to the limits of the stability. This has necessitated the implementation of techniques for analyzing and detecting voltage collapse in bus bar or lines prior to its occurrence. Simple Newton Raphson algorithm based voltage stability analysis has been carried out. Matlab based simulations for all the factors that causes voltage instability has been implemented and analyzed for an IEEE 30 bus system. The proposed model is able to identify the behavior of the power systems, network under various voltage stability conditions and its possibility of recovery/stability improvement of the power system network has been discussed.</p>
The main Objective of this research work is to develop a simple load flow calculator in LabVIEW for three phase power system Network. LabVIEW based load flow calculator has been chosen as the main platform because it is a user friendly and easy to apply in Power Systems. This research work is designed to concurrently familiarize the power system engineers with the use of LabVIEW with electrical power systems. This proposed work will discuss design and development of the interactive instructional virtual instrument (VI) modules in power systems load flow solutions. In the proposed model load flow has been carried out based on gaussseidal method and model has been developed such that it can accommodate latest versions of load flow algorithm.
<p class="Abstract">This paper mainly focuses on the cable sizing methods and calculation of electrical cables according to the various international standards. For instance, International Electrotechnical Commission (IEC), National Electrical Code (NEC), British Standard (BS) and Institute of Electrical and Electronics Engineers (IEEE). The basic philosophy underlying any cable sizing calculations are the same. The main objective of this research work is to develop effective cable sizing model for building services.</p>
